James - 6th Mar 2007 5:28 FYI - I have the JVC AV-32432 TV, and the user manual says that if the 'on timer' light is blinking, that there is a problem, to "unplug the set and call for service"...i know it's as clear as mud, but at least you all know that even the JVC manual doesn't have a quick and easy solution!
- Re[2]: JVC service or questions
JB38 - 6th Mar 2007 11:15 A blinking timer light on any JVC TV is an indication that the power unit has shut down because there is a defect in the internal circuitry, this usually something that if allowed to continue could either damage the tube or cause components to overheat, rectification of same requiring the problem to be investigated by qualified technical personnel.

kim - 6th Mar 2007 6:35 hi i have a JVC GR-DX77U and i tried playing this mini dv which was recorded from another video, and it keeps on displaying, "tape in safeguard mode; eject and reinsert again." how can i take it out from safegurad mode?? urgent reply would be appreciated.. thanks!
- Re[2]: JVC service or questions
JB38 - 6th Mar 2007 11:22 Try your camcorder with a tape previously recorded in your 77U just to make sure its still working, and if it is then the tape you are trying which was recorded on another camcorder is possibly wound on too tightly as JVC camcorders are super (over) sensitive to this sort of thing.
